It stands on a shallow indentation of the black sea coast at a point approximately 19 miles (31 km) north of the dniester river estuary and about 275 miles (443 km) south of kyiv.

Odessa was established in 1794 by the empress catherine the great on land conquered from the ottoman empire on the site of the black sea fortress town of khadzhibei.
